From: Effects of monoclonal anti-PcrV antibody on Pseudomonas aeruginosa-induced acute lung injury in a rat model

Figure 4

The oxygenation of arterial blood. The oxygen pressure of the arterial blood was measured for 4 h in the rats. A. Either irrelevant monoclonal IgG (Control IgG, filled squares), rabbit polyclonal anti-PcrV IgG (Rab anti-PcrV, open diamonds), or murine monoclonal anti-PcrV IgG (Mab166, open circles) (4 mg/kg, respectively) was co-instilled with P. aeruginosa PA103 (5 × 107 CUF) in the airspaces of the rats. B. Either PBS without IgG (w/o IgG, filled squares), rabbit polyclonal anti-PcrV IgG (Rab anti-PcrV, open diamonds), murine monoclonal anti-PcrV IgG (Mab166, open circles), or Fab fragments Mab166 (Mab166 Fab, open triangles) (4 mg/kg, respectively) was intratracheally instilled one hour after the airspace instillation of P. aeruginosa PA103 (5 × 107 CUF). Data are shown as means ± standard errors. The numbers of animals are listed in Table 1.
